Spotting damp & mould in Swavesey
- ✓Black spots on walls, ceilings or sealant
- ✓Condensation on the windows each morning
- ✓A persistent damp smell that won't go away
- ✓Peeling paint or damp patches on the walls
- ✓Cold, damp-feeling walls

What you'll pay in Swavesey
Hiring beats buying when the need is short-term (after a wet winter, a leak, or before a sale). In Swavesey, expect around £10 to £25 a day depending on the model, with discounts over a week or more.

How quickly will it dry my room?
Most rooms feel noticeably less damp within 2 to 3 days; a soaked cellar or fresh plaster in Swavesey can take a week or two. We'll suggest a sensible hire length when you ask.
